Getting Great Reviews as a Host

By Belo Rentals · Updated June 2026

Reviews are the engine of a successful listing: they improve your visibility and let you raise your rates over time. The good news is that great reviews come from a few controllable habits. This guide covers them.

Nail cleanliness and accuracy

The two most common review themes are how clean the car was and whether it matched the listing. Hand off a spotless car that looks exactly like your photos, and you've earned most of a five-star review before the trip even starts.

Communicate quickly and clearly

Fast, friendly responses before and during the trip make guests feel taken care of. Confirm handoff details, be reachable during the rental, and follow up politely at return.

  • Respond quickly to every message
  • Confirm pickup, return, and expectations
  • Be reachable during the trip
  • Handle issues calmly and fairly

Make the handoff smooth

A quick walkthrough of the car's features, clear expectations, and an easy return process leave a strong final impression — and the return is what guests remember when they write the review.

Turn issues into recoveries

Problems happen; how you handle them defines the review. Respond calmly, document with photos, and resolve fairly. A well-handled hiccup often still earns a strong review.
